Launch 2 urls from one flash button
Hi,
I have a Flash button, which I want to use getURL to both
- call the Google Analytics tracking function
- send the user to a new page
on (release) {
getURL("javascript:pageTracker._trackPageview('/folder/file.html');");
getURL("some web page");
Currently, only one of these getURL calls works. How can I
get the one Flash function to use getURL twice? Or do I have to do
something different?
Thanks!you cannot make javascript calls using a getURL as of player
9 rev 124. The new security restrictions prevent it, as it is an
insecure method of communication.
To call the javascript function, use the ExternalInterface
class. -
Adding a url to flash buttons in Dreamweaver
I have a web site built and I have recently added Flash buttons and I need to add my web pages to the buttons. How would I go about doing this?
Let's say you create a button symbol. Since it is a button, it is already a self animating object that will react to mouse interactions, but only visually at this stage. The first thing you need to do to make it useful code-wise is to assign it a unique instance name. So you drag a copy of it out to the stage from the library, and while it's still selected, you enter that unique instance name for it in the Properties panel... let's say you name it "btn1"
In AS3, to make a button work with code, you need to add an event listener and event handler function for it. You might need to add a few (for different events, like rollover, rollout, clicking it, but for now we'll just say you want to be able to click it to get a web page to open. In the timeline that holds that button, in a separate actions layer that you create, in a frame numbered the same as where that button exists, you would add the event listener:
btn1.addEventListener(MouseEvent.CLICK, btn1Click);
The name of the unique function for processing the clicking of that button is specified at the end of the event listener assignment, so now you just have to write that function out:
function btn1Click(evt:MouseEvent):void {
var url:String = "http://www.awebsite.com/awebpage.html";
var req:URLRequest = new URLRequest(url);
navigateToURL(req); -
How do i actionscript my flash button to play the sound while being transfered to another url?
Hi!
As the title says:
How do i get my flash button to play my sound when i click on
it while being transfered to another url?
I did get it to work, but only when i set the script to
"_BLANK". When i clicked the button then it played the sound and
opened the url in a new window. I want it to be in the same window
and still play the whole sound.
Now i get just 1 or 2 sec then when im transfered, it stops
playing the sound.
I hope this explains it..... if any typo....its because im
Swedish =)
Thanks in advance!If you are jumping to another URL using the same window you
cannot have a sound start on the press of a button and that sound
to continue on.
Reason
You are removing all trace of the sound and the swf that
contains that sound file.
Work arounds
1.Take a look at "frames". This way you are keeping the
container page and opening another page inside of that page.
2. Div's. again you are importing a page into a particular
area yet keeping the swf, with the sound playing, in the parent
frame. -

Flash button problem when scrolling
Hello.
I posted this in Dreamweaver forum as well....just in case.
I am using flash buttons for email links in my web site
rather than html email links to help with spamming.
They work great except for one thing. In my site I have a
fixed Div on the left of my pages. The content scrolls sideways
underneath the fixed div. However....the flash buttons scroll over
the TOP of the fixed div while the rest of the content goes under
as it is supposed to. I have the fixed div set at z-index of 2.
This isn't an issue in Firefox, only IE7, so far.
Any one know of an easy fix for this rather than creating a
new div for each of the buttons?
Here is the link to the problem page - its the email link in
red towards the end of the page. Watch the link go OVER the drums
as you scroll. (it should go under)
http://dev.informarch.com/wm/article3/flashBtnScrollexample.html
Thanks in advance for any help.
KenHello,
Try this and see if it works
In your HTML go to where the <object> tag is that loads
your flash button.
Add this parameter within it.
<param name="wmode" value="transparent">
Then add the following inside the <embed> tag
wmode="transparent"
This is taken from an article from this site
http://www.bigismore.com/flash-related/flash-zorder-always-on-top/ -
